My husband and dog whisperer, Andrew Harrington, and I talk in about our overly anxious and under trained mini-Australian Shepherd, General Heppenheimer Harrington aka Hep.
Listen as two townies tell their revisionist sides of history regarding who wanted to bring a puppy into the fold, who trained or improperly trained the canine, who considers him a comrade and who considers him an enemy, who endures the wrath of his spite poops and exactly how many people has he bit? Tune in for some tales of a dog who only remains in our house because my husband is loyal—to a fault.
